Ammocleonus hieroglyphicus, the desert weevil, is a species of cylindrical weevil belonging to the family Curculionidae.

Description[edit]

Ammocleonus hieroglyphicus reaches a length of about 15 millimetres (0.59 in).

Distribution[edit]

This species is widespread in Africa and Asia.
